from io import BytesIO

from pyrogram.raw.core.primitives import Int, Long, Int128, Int256, Bool, Bytes, String, Double, Vector
from pyrogram.raw.core import TLObject
from pyrogram import raw
from typing import List, Optional, Any

# #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# #
#               !!! WARNING !!!               #
#          This is a generated file!          #
# All changes made in this file will be lost! #
# #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# # #


[docs] class ChatReactionsAll(TLObject): # type: ignore """All reactions or all non-custom reactions are allowed Constructor of :obj:`~pyrogram.raw.base.ChatReactions`. Details: - Layer: ``229`` - ID: ``52928BCA`` Parameters: allow_custom (``bool``, *optional*): Whether to allow custom reactions """ __slots__: List[str] = ["allow_custom"] ID = 0x52928bca QUALNAME = "types.ChatReactionsAll" def __init__(self, *, allow_custom: Optional[bool] = None) -> None: self.allow_custom = allow_custom # flags.0?true @staticmethod def read(b: BytesIO, *args: Any) -> "ChatReactionsAll": flags = Int.read(b) allow_custom = True if flags & (1 << 0) else False return ChatReactionsAll(allow_custom=allow_custom) def write(self, *args) -> bytes: b = BytesIO() b.write(Int(self.ID, False)) flags = 0 flags |= (1 << 0) if self.allow_custom else 0 b.write(Int(flags)) return b.getvalue()
